89
results
Sold prices in Tremaine Road, Croydon, SE20
The Upper Flat At, 11a Tremaine Road, London, SE20 7UA
- £125,000 Flat, Leasehold 27 May 2002
69 Tremaine Road, London, SE20 7UA
- £174,000 Terraced, Freehold 11 February 2002
47a Tremaine Road, London, SE20 7UA
- £112,500 Flat, Leasehold 26 October 2001
22a Tremaine Road, London, SE20 7TZ
- £98,000 Terraced, Freehold 26 October 2001
42 Tremaine Road, London, SE20 7TZ
- £162,500 Terraced, Freehold 31 July 2001
48 Tremaine Road, London, SE20 7TZ
- £135,000 Terraced, Freehold 13 July 2001
29 Tremaine Road, London, SE20 7UA
- £122,000 Flat, Leasehold 15 June 2001
14 Tremaine Road, London, SE20 7TZ
- £99,000 Flat, Leasehold 23 June 2000
45 Tremaine Road, London, SE20 7UA
- £102,000 Flat, Leasehold 26 May 2000
34 Tremaine Road, London, SE20 7TZ
- £138,500 Terraced, Freehold 17 December 1999
Ground Floor Flat, 11a Tremaine Road, London, SE20 7UA
- £49,500 Flat, Leasehold 24 March 1998
58 Tremaine Road, London, SE20 7TZ
- £96,000 Terraced, Freehold 27 January 1998
77 Tremaine Road, London, SE20 7UA
- £93,000 Terraced, Freehold 20 May 1997
35a Tremaine Road, London, SE20 7UA
- £47,500 Terraced, Freehold 08 May 1997
1 Tremaine Road, London, SE20 7UA
- £47,000 Flat, Leasehold 28 August 1996
60 Tremaine Road, London, SE20 7TZ
- £74,000 Semi-detached, Freehold 20 June 1996
57 Tremaine Road, London, SE20 7UA
- £14,500 Terraced, Freehold 11 April 1995